C200C Front Panel Controls, Displays, Push-Buttons, and Switches

BALANCE control

allows the adjustment

of the relative volume

levels for each channel

and is used for setup

functions

POWER

switch turns

all AC power

completely On

or Off

RECORD switch selects

the program signals that

are available to record

from and is used for setup

functions

LIS PROCESSOR

push-button turns

the Listen Processor

loop On or Off

LISTEN switch selects

the program signals

that are listened to and

unbalanced outputs

VOLUME control

adjusts the listening

volume level and is

used for setup func-

tions

DISPLAY indicates the Listen and

Record Sources, Listening Volume

Level and Setup Functions

REC PROCESSOR

push-button turns the

Record Processor

loop On or Off

REC MONITOR

push-button

switches the

RECORD Output

signals to the Listen

circuit so the Pro-

gram Signals sent to

the Record outputs

are audible

MONO push-button

combines left and

right stereo signals to

mono at all Main,

Amplifier and Listen

Outputs

SETUP allows the

changing of the

default settings for

Inputs, Levels and

the Display

DISPLAY push-button

switches the display to

indicate either volume

level in dB, or percent of

maximum volume

MUTE push-button

mutes audio in all

Listen Outputs

OUTPUTS 1 and 2 push-buttons

allow the C200 to switch Power

Control and Audio to two sepa-

rate stereo power amplifiers

STANDBY/ON push-button

turns the C200 On, or Off

(Standby)

IR Sensor for

Remote Con-

trol Operation
